Understanding Trust Disputes

Trust disputes arise when there are disagreements among beneficiaries, trustees, or other parties involved in a trust. These conflicts can stem from various issues, including the interpretation of trust terms, alleged breaches of fiduciary duty, or dissatisfaction with the management of trust assets. Trusts are legal arrangements designed to manage and distribute assets according to the grantor’s wishes, and when disputes occur, they can disrupt the intended outcomes and create significant stress for all parties involved.

Common Causes of Trust Disputes in Daytona Beach

In Daytona Beach, several factors frequently contribute to trust disputes:

  1. Ambiguous Trust Documents: Vague or unclear language in the trust document can lead to different interpretations, causing confusion and disagreement among beneficiaries.
  2. Mismanagement of Trust Assets: Trustees are legally obligated to manage trust assets prudently. Allegations of mismanagement, such as poor investment decisions or misuse of funds, can prompt beneficiaries to challenge the trustee’s actions.
  3. Breach of Fiduciary Duty: Trustees have a fiduciary duty to act in the best interests of the beneficiaries. Failure to uphold this duty, whether through negligence or intentional misconduct, can result in legal disputes.
  4. Lack of Communication: Poor communication between trustees and beneficiaries can lead to misunderstandings and mistrust, escalating minor issues into significant conflicts.
  5. Changes in Circumstances: Life events such as the death of a beneficiary, divorce, or significant changes in financial status can trigger disputes as parties reassess their interests and rights within the trust.

The Legal Process in Trust Disputes

Resolving trust disputes typically involves several legal steps, each requiring careful consideration and strategic action:

  1. Initial Consultation: The first step is to consult with a knowledgeable trust disputes attorney who can assess the situation, review relevant documents, and provide an overview of your legal options.
  2. Filing a Lawsuit: If negotiations fail, the next step may involve filing a lawsuit to challenge the trust or seek specific remedies. This process includes drafting and filing the necessary legal documents with the court.
  3. Discovery: Both parties engage in discovery, exchanging information and evidence pertinent to the dispute. This phase may involve depositions, interrogatories, and requests for documents.
  4. Mediation and Settlement: Many trust disputes are resolved through mediation or settlement negotiations, allowing parties to reach an agreement without going to trial.
  5. Trial: If a settlement cannot be reached, the dispute proceeds to trial, where a judge or jury will hear the case and make a binding decision.
  6. Appeals: Either party may appeal the court’s decision if they believe there were legal errors that affected the outcome of the case.
